Cabin window replacement services involve removing old or damaged windows and installing new ones that improve both the appearance and functionality of a property. This process typically includes measuring the existing window openings, selecting suitable replacement styles, and securely fitting the new windows to ensure proper insulation and operation. These services are designed to enhance the overall look of a cabin or home while providing better energy efficiency, noise reduction, and security. Skilled contractors handle the entire installation, making sure the new windows are properly sealed and aligned to prevent drafts and leaks.
Many property owners turn to window replacement when facing issues such as cracked or broken glass, drafts around the window frame, or difficulty opening and closing windows. Over time, windows can become foggy, warped, or damaged, which can compromise insulation and increase energy bills. Replacement services help address these problems by upgrading to newer, more durable window options that offer improved insulation and security features. The overview below groups typical Cabin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in New Berlin, WI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or window replacements or repairs, local contractors in the New Berlin area typ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on window size and materials used.
Standard Replacement - Full replacement of standard cabin windows usually costs between $600 and $1,200 per window. Most projects in this category are priced within this range, with fewer exceeding higher amounts for premium materials.
Large or Custom Projects - Larger, more complex window replacements, such as custom-sized or multi-pane installations, can range from $1,200 to $3,000 or more per window. These projects are less common but may be necessary for unique cabin designs.
Full Cabin Window Overhaul - Complete replacement of all cabin windows often falls between $10,000 and $25,000, depending on the number of windows and the scope of work. Larger, more elaborate projects can reach higher costs but are less typical for standard cabins.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of replacing cabin windows? Replacing cabin windows can improve energy efficiency, enhance natural light, and update the overall appearance of the cabin interior and exterior.
How do I choose the right type of window for my cabin? Local contractors can help determine the best window styles and materials based on the cabin’s location, design, and your preferences.
Can replacing cabin windows help with insulation? Yes, modern replacement windows often offer better insulation properties, which can help maintain indoor comfort and reduce energy costs.
What should I consider when selecting window materials for a cabin? Factors such as durability, maintenance requirements, and resistance to weather conditions are important when choosing window materials for a cabin.
How do local service providers handle installation of cabin windows? Experienced contractors typically handle removal of old windows, proper fitting of new units, and ensure a secure, weather-tight seal during installation.
